WACS.ComponentModel.Harness.Lib

Build-time IL emitter for typed WIT harnesses. Takes a WIT contract (either a directory of .wit files or a pre-parsed CtPackage set) and emits a .NET assembly containing the typed {World}Harness class with LoadFrom(byte[]) + per-export typed methods.

Targets net9.0 to use PersistedAssemblyBuilder for the AOT-clean save+load round-trip.

Two ergonomic surfaces over one emit core

using Wacs.ComponentModel.Harness.Lib;

// Persisted (the `wacs harness gen` flow) — emit a .dll on disk
HarnessEmitter.EmitToFile(
    witDirectory: "./wit",
    outputPath:   "./HelloHarness.dll",
    options:      new HarnessOptions { Namespace = "MyApp.Generated" });

// In-memory (the `wacs run --wit-dir` flow) — load + use immediately
Assembly asm = HarnessEmitter.EmitInMemory("./wit");
Type harness = asm.GetType("Wacs.ComponentModel.Harness.Generated.HelloHarness");
var instance = harness.GetMethod("LoadFrom")!
    .Invoke(null, new object[] { File.ReadAllBytes("hello.component.wasm") });

// Lowest-level: bring your own Stream
using var ms = new MemoryStream();
HarnessEmitter.EmitToStream("./wit", ms);

Both shapes funnel through one EmitToStream so the emit path stays single-source. Mirrors the way Wacs.Transpiler.Lib exposes both Bake-to-memory and SaveAssembly-to-disk paths.

What the emitted harness looks like

For a world like:

package example:hello@0.1.0;
world hello {
    export greet: func(name: string) -> string;
}

The emitter produces:

namespace Wacs.ComponentModel.Harness.Generated
{
    public sealed class HelloHarness
    {
        public static HelloHarness LoadFrom(byte[] componentBytes) { … }

        public string Greet(string name) { … }
    }
}

…where the body of Greet is canonical-ABI IL: lower the string into wasm linear memory via cabi_realloc, call the core export, lift the return string back out. The IL only calls into WACS.ComponentModel.Harness.Runtime and WACS — no reflection at the call site.

Cross-engine symmetry

The interpreter-side {World}Harness (this package) and the transpiler-side {World}HarnessImpl : I{World} (emitted by Wacs.Transpiler.Lib) both implement the same I{World} contract. The engine choice becomes a deployment choice, not an API choice — embedders bind once and swap the underlying runtime.

See docs/WIT_HARNESS_APPROACH.md for the full cross-engine story.

How it relates to the other WACS packages

.wit files
   │
   ▼  (build time, via WACS.Cli or programmatically)
WACS.ComponentModel.Harness.Lib   ──► {World}Harness.dll
   │ references at build time              │
   ▼                                       ▼ links against at runtime
WACS.ComponentModel.Parser           WACS.ComponentModel.Harness.Runtime
WACS.ComponentModel                  WACS  (interpreter)
WACS.Core
Package Role
WACS.ComponentModel.Harness.Lib this — the emitter; build-time tool
WACS.ComponentModel.Harness.Runtime The runtime primitives emitted harness DLLs link against
WACS.ComponentModel.Parser Read the .component.wasm shape
WACS.ComponentModel WIT parsing + canonical-ABI infrastructure the emitter consumes at build time
WACS.Cli wacs harness gen verb wraps EmitToFile; wacs run --wit-dir wraps EmitInMemory
WACS.Transpiler.Lib Alternative engine — emits a {World}HarnessImpl : I{World} against the same I{World} contract

When to use this

  • You have a .component.wasm shipped with a known WIT world and want a typed C# wrapper for it.
  • You want the emitted harness as a build artifact — checked in, shipped alongside your app, callable without the emitter in the runtime image.
  • You want to keep the runtime image AOT-safe (NativeAOT or Unity IL2CPP). The emitted IL only references the AOT-safe Harness.Runtime package.

For the dependency-injection consumer shape (the AddWacs*-style fluent extension methods), pair with the host-package DI siblings (WACS.WASI.Preview2.DependencyInjection, etc.) — the harness sits underneath those layers.
